The Core Strategy: Bonus Mathematics and Wagering Scenarios

This is the operational heart of the guide. A no deposit bonus is not free money; it is a contingent credit with strict conversion rules. Let’s model a hypothetical but realistic offer based on common industry standards for Rolletto: £10 Bonus with 40x Wagering Requirement, a 50x Maximum Win Cap, and a £100 Withdrawal Limit.

Scenario 1: The Basic Wagering Calculation
You claim the £10 no deposit bonus. The WR is 40x the bonus amount. Therefore, before any winnings from the bonus become withdrawable, you must wager: £10 * 40 = £400 in total. This is not a loss limit; it is the total turnover required. If you play slots with a 100% contribution rate, every £1 bet counts as £1 towards the WR. If you play table games like blackjack (often 10% contribution), a £10 bet would only count as £1 towards the WR, making the effective requirement £4,000 to clear – a near-impossible task.

Scenario 2: Incorporating Game Weighting and Realistic Playthrough
Assume you use your entire £10 bonus on a slot game with a 96% RTP (Return to Player). The expected loss during wagering is factored in. To clear the £400 WR, you will place many bets. The statistical expectation is that you will retain a fraction of the original bonus. More critically, you must track the Maximum Win Cap. If your cap is 50x the bonus (£500), even if you miraculously turn £10 into £600 while wagering, only £500 will be convertible to cash. The rest is forfeit.

Scenario 3: The Withdrawal Limit in Practice
You successfully clear the £400 WR and have £150 in your bonus-derived balance. However, the promotion stipulates a maximum withdrawal from the no deposit bonus of £100. This is a critical and often overlooked term. You can only cash out £100. The remaining £50 will be removed from your account upon withdrawal request. The strategic aim is to manage your gameplay to approach, but not exceed, this £100 limit during the wagering process to avoid value forfeiture.

Banking: The Withdrawal Pathway for No Deposit Winnings

Cashing out from a no deposit bonus involves an additional layer of scrutiny. The process is deliberately friction-heavy to prevent bonus abuse.

  1. Verification is Mandatory: Before any withdrawal, you must complete full KYC. This means uploading a government-issued ID (passport, driver’s license), a recent utility bill or bank statement for address proof, and sometimes a copy of your payment method.
  2. Withdrawal Request: Once wagering is complete and funds are in your main balance, navigate to the cashier and select a withdrawal method. Common options include Bank Transfer, e-Wallets (Skrill, Neteller), or Debit Cards. Note: Some casinos impose fees or minimum amounts.
  3. The Limit Enforcement: The system will automatically deduct any amount over the stated no deposit withdrawal limit (e.g., £100). Your request will be processed for the allowable sum only.
  4. Processing Time: Expect 1-5 business days for processing, plus additional time for the bank transfer to clear. E-wallets are typically fastest.

Troubleshooting Common No Deposit Bonus Issues

Technical hiccups are common. Here’s a diagnostic and resolution guide:

  • Bonus Not Credited After Registration: Cause: The offer may require a manual claim from the Promotions page, or you may have used an ineligible payment method during sign-up (some bonuses void if you deposit first). Fix: Log in, visit ‘Promotions’, click ‘Claim’. If absent, contact support with clear screenshots.
  • Wagering Progress Not Updating: Cause: You are playing games with low contribution percentages. Fix: Switch to eligible slots (check the bonus terms for the list). Refresh your browser or app.
  • Withdrawal Request Rejected: Cause: Incomplete KYC, wagering not fully met, or attempting to withdraw over the no deposit limit. Fix: Complete verification, double-check your wagering status in the bonus account section, and ensure your requested amount aligns with the promotion’s cashout cap.
  • Bonus Expired Before Wagering Complete: Cause: The validity period (e.g., 7 days) elapsed. Fix: This is irreversible. The bonus and any winnings derived from it will be forfeited. Always note the expiry time upon claiming.
